    Interesting stats when Kyler runs the ball.

    In the 12 games Murray has carried the football at least 10 times, the Cardinals sport a 10-2 record. Widen that metric to at least five totes per game for Murray and Arizona is still over .500 at 26-20. But 0-13-1 record when he has carried less than 5 times.
